In a wide-open handicap, SIUL MOLLY SIUL is taken to bounce back from her fall at Cork, having previously looked the type do to better over this sort of distance in handicaps. Hob's Angel hasn't progressed over fences but has claims on the best of her hurdles form from earlier this year, while Milanaway should be more competitive following her recent reappearance.
